Friending Your Boss On Facebook

Think Twice Before Adding Your Boss Or Work Colleagues To Your Network

(CBS)  Susan Barnett of CBS3 in Philadelphia reports on things to think about before adding your boss to your Facebook friends list.

Barnett spoke with Carole Weintraub, an HR representative and president of Beaumont Staffing.

"I'm not a big believer in Facebook because it's an overlap of personal life and professional life," said Weintraub.

She checked out some real-life Facebook posts, such as someone drinking coffee and wishing she was not at work. An employer can't like seeing that.

"No, I wouldn't think that they would," said Weintraub.
